IEC 61850 DATA SET:
LLN0 GOOSE# Error
Latched target message: No.
Description of problem: A data item in a configurable GOOSE data set is not supported by the F35 order code.
How often the test is performed: On power up
What to do: Verify that all the items in the GOOSE data set are supported by the F35. The EnerVista UR Setup soft-
ware will list the valid items. An IEC61850 client will also show which nodes are available for the F35.
IEC 61850 DATA SET:
LLN0 BR# Error
Latched target message: No.
Description of problem: A data item in a configurable report data set is not supported by the F35 order code.
How often the test is performed: On power up
What to do: Verify that all the items in the configurable report data set are supported by the F35. The EnerVista UR
Setup software will list the valid items. An IEC61850 client will also show which nodes are available for the F35.
MAINTENANCE ALERT:
Replace Battery
Latched target message: Yes.
Description of problem: The battery is not functioning.
How often the test is performed: The battery is monitored every five seconds. The error message displays after 60 sec-
onds if the problem persists
What to do: Replace the battery as outlined in the Maintenance chapter.
MAINTENANCE ALERT:
Direct I/O Ring Break
Latched target message: No.
Description of problem: Direct input and output settings are configured for a ring, but the connection is not in a ring.
How often the test is performed: Every second
What to do: Check direct input and output configuration and wiring.
MAINTENANCE ALERT:
ENET PORT # OFFLINE
Latched target message: No.
Description of problem: The Ethernet connection has failed for the specified port.
How often the test is performed: Every five seconds.
What to do: Check the Ethernet port connection on the switch.
